2012 TFF Legacy Team?
So, 2012 is here, the 2011 legacy team has been created and awarded. Shall we start discussing the legacy team for 2012?
Here's the list of previous teams:
2003 Goblin
2004 Chaos
2005 Skaven
2006 Dark Elves
2007 Chaos Dwarf
2008 Chaos Pact
2009 Necromantic
2010 Human
2011 Orcs
The long-list of possible teams is Amazons, Dwarfs, Elves, Halflings, High Elves, Lizardmen, Norse, Ogres, Slann, Tomb Kings, Undead, Vampires or Wood Elves
